Hardcover. Condizione: new. Hardcover. Keith Negley's playful and emotional art tells this story of a new father who is no longer the cool guy he once was. He looks back wistfully on his crazy times playing in a band, riding a motorcycle, and getting tattoos. Those days may be behind him, but his young son still thinks he's the coolest guy in the world.Keith Negley is an award-winning editorial illustrator with a penchant for emotionally driven illustration. He's been published in a wide range of major newspapers and national magazines, and is a frequent contributor to the" New York Times "and "New Yorker." He lives in the mountains of Bellingham, Washington, surrounded by rain forests and giant spiders. This is his second book for Flying Eye, following "Tough Guys Have Feelings Too!" A new father reflects on no longer being cool, but he learns his child still thinks he's pretty awesome. In the first graphic anthology to be produced by Nobrow, twenty-four artists take on seven pages each. to tell their tales of the creation of everything. Drawn from the mythology of myriad cultures and the ever creative minds of the artists within, we are taken from the fog of Niflheim to the frescoes of Florence in a worldwide collaboration of yarn spinning humored tales. Presented here is an exploration of a tradition in visual storytelling - without specific endorsement of any particular belief or religion - on the nature of creation. Beautiful offset printing utilized throughout featuring full-page and paneled designs from artists such as Stuart Kolakovic, Ben Newman, Mike Bertino, Brecht Vandenbroucke, and Luke Pearson. Best described as graphic short stories with accompanying minimal text. Printed in Spain. 174 pages. Insured post. "A Graphic Cosmogony is the first anthology from publishers Nobrow Press. This is a Nobrow equivalent of McSweeney s albeit with a very deliberate theme. The twenty-four artists tackle creation in a fitting seven pages each - each one becoming that shamanic presence, creating their own wild, imaginative versions to answer that perennial question: 'how did we get here?' - Forbidden Planet International "The Biblical creation myth proposes that God created the world in seven days, or six plus one day, so in that spirit the two-dozen cartoonist-shamans corralled into this compendium were given just seven pages to devise their own version of how we all got here. Entire world faiths have been built on equally unlikely accounts. Perhaps if enough readers of this volume start believing in certain stories, they might cause a spate of new religions to spring up based upon them. Pull up a rock and gather round the flickering fire the universe is about to be born again." - From the introduction by freelance journalist, curator, and lecturer Paul Gravett, co-author of Graphic Novels: Stories to Change Your Life.
